提升Ubuntu上MongoDB性能可从以下方面入手:
硬件与系统优化
MongoDB配置优化
/etc/mongod.conf:
storage.wiredTiger.engineConfig.cacheSizeGB(建议设为可用内存的50%-70%)。net.maxIncomingConnections等以适应高并发。operationProfiling监控慢查询。索引优化
分片与集群
查询与软件层面优化
explain()分析查询计划,避免低效操作。监控与维护
mongostat、mongotop或第三方工具(如PMM)监控性能。mongodump/mongorestore工具。注意:优化前需在测试环境验证效果,避免影响生产环境。